2020 -21 Aleinu Classes
In keeping with our Aleinu model, we will offer a different class each week rotating throughout the month. This slate and schedule is subject to change. If you have any comments, please make them known.
Jewish GOAT. No, not a class on Chad Gadya. GOAT as in 'Greatest Of All Time.' In this class, Rabbi Sagal will explore the greatest Jewish ideas in all of our history. Ideas that challenge the mind, raise your spirits, and uncover the Jewish spin on just about everything that makes us who we are.
Cooking 201. Chef Margo's "cooking show" will be 2 hours and the course will parallel our SHMA curriculum: Food of the Jewish Immigrants and Foods of Israel. Ingredients will be sent in advance and student will prepare the dishes while Margo demonstrates.
A Narrow Bridge: Jewish in the Pandemic 201. Moreh Mike will lead the class that continues what we began last year: exploring Jewish perspectives on life's challenges like the pandemic. Most important, this hour provides an opportunity for each student to express how they are coping with this challenging time.
Social Action 101. A class based on the T'ruah action webinars in which a presenter highlights a social justice issue and offers an action plan to do something, e.g., call your congressman, send letters to the newspaper, etc. Students will take action!
